An error is received when trying to restart the 'MCS Onepoint Admin Service'. (NETIQKB13267)

Directory and Resource Administrator 6.x

symptom
An error is received when trying to restart the 'MCS Onepoint Admin Service'.

symptom
After demoting the Directory and Resource Administrator server from a DC to a member server, an error occurs when trying to restart the 'MCS Onepoint Admin Service'.

symptom

Error: '1053 the service did not respond to the start or control request in a timely fashion'.



symptom

The application log contains an Event ID 1000 'Windows cannot load your registry file' with a source of 'userenv'.



cause
This issue is a result of the security of the Registry not being able to resolve the Administrators SID.

fix

The above issue can be resolved by rfollowing these steps:

  1. Log into the DRA server as the service account.
  2. Try to start the MCS Onepoint Administration Service.  If unsuccessful, click Start | Run.
  3. Enter regedt32.
  4. Click the Security menu and select Permissions.
  5. Highlight the Adminstrators group and click Remove and Apply.
  6. Select Add and re-add the Adminstrators group.
  7. Close Regedt32.
  8. Restart the MCS Onepoint Administration Service.
